开发一个数字门店小程序系统是一个复杂的过程,涉及多个步骤。以下是开发数字门店小程序系统的一般步骤:
1. 需求分析:
(1) 与潜在用户进行沟通,了解他们的需求和期望。
(2) 确定小程序的主要功能,如商品展示、在线购物、订单管理、支付方式、客户服务等。
(3) 确定目标用户群体,包括年龄、性别、兴趣等。
2. 市场调研:
(1) 研究竞争对手的小程序,了解他们的功能、用户体验和营销策略。
(2) 分析行业趋势,确保小程序符合市场需求。
3. 规划设计:
(1) 制定详细的项目计划,包括时间表、预算和资源分配。
(2) 设计小程序的用户界面和用户体验,确保简洁、直观且易于使用。
(3) 确定技术栈,选择合适的开发框架和工具。
4. 技术选型:
(1) 选择合适的编程语言和开发平台。
(2) 确定数据库管理系统,如mysql、mongodb等。
(3) 选择云服务提供商,如阿里云、腾讯云等。
5. 原型设计与开发:
(1) 制作小程序的原型图,包括页面布局、导航、按钮等。
(2) 开发小程序的基础框架,实现核心功能。
(3) 进行内部测试,修复发现的问题。
6. 功能开发:
(1) 根据需求分析的结果,逐步开发和完善小程序的各项功能。
(2) 实现商品展示、购物车、订单管理、支付接口等功能。
(3) 添加用户认证、权限管理等安全特性。
7. 测试与优化:
(1) 进行全面的测试,包括单元测试、集成测试、性能测试和安全测试。
(2) 根据测试结果进行代码优化和bug修复。
(3) 确保小程序在不同设备和浏览器上的兼容性。
8. 上线与推广:
(1) 将小程序提交给相应的平台审核,通过后发布上线。
(2) 制定推广计划,利用社交媒体、广告等方式吸引用户。
(3) 收集用户反馈,持续优化小程序的功能和体验。
9. 维护与更新:
(1) 定期检查小程序的性能和安全性,及时修复漏洞。
(2) 根据用户反馈和新的需求,不断更新和改进小程序的功能。
(3) 提供技术支持和售后服务,提升用户满意度。
10. 数据分析与优化:
(1) 收集并分析小程序的用户数据,了解用户行为和偏好。
(2) 根据数据分析结果,调整运营策略,提高转化率和用户留存率。
总之,开发一个数字门店小程序系统需要从需求分析开始,经过规划设计、技术开发、测试优化、上线推广、维护更新等多个阶段,最终实现一个高效、易用、稳定的小程序系统。